Band Management job scope includes:
Brand Strategy Development: Analyze business and consumer trends, identify key issues facing your business and build and execute innovative marketing plans.
Team Leadership: Lead cross-functional teams in the development and execution of marketing plan strategies – including advertising, product development, packaging, trade and consumer promotions, and business operation of your brand
Innovation: Identify new, innovative ideas to drive brand growth. Develop new product ideas and strategies. Create high-impact promotions, advertising, packaging, sales or operational innovation
Goal Setting and Financial Management: Set annual volume, profit and share objectives and manage your business to deliver them.
